Sharjah Airport Welcomes Fly Jinnah, Boosts Connectivity
Sharjah: In a momentous occasion, Sharjah Airport proudly welcomed the inaugural flight of Fly Jinnah, a prominent low-cost carrier operating in Pakistan and jointly operated by the Lakson Group of Pakistan and Air Arabia Group of the UAE. The arrival marked the beginning of a strategic partnership aimed at enhancing connectivity between Islamabad and Sharjah, with Fly Jinnah offering passengers two daily flights on this route.
The welcoming ceremony, attended by key dignitaries including Ali Salim Al Midfa, Chairman of Sharjah Airport Authority, Faisal Niaz Tirmizi, Ambassador of the Islamic Republic of Pakistan to the UAE, Adel Al Ali, Group Chief Executive Officer of Air Arabia, and Iqbal Ali Lakhani, Chairman of Fly Jinnah, highlighted the significance of this collaboration in strengthening aviation ties between the two countries.
